About the role

MediaViz builds digital media intelligence solutions and novel content perception models that help machines understand and evaluate the relationships between photos, videos, and audio at scale. We're hiring a Senior Backend Engineer to own the backend systems and infrastructure that ingest media, orchestrate model inference, process results, and deliver structured outputs to customers.

You won't be training models in this role, but you'll have primary responsibility for the environments in which they run and a distributed I/O pipeline that processes large, highly bursty workloads with high reliability requirements. To that end, we're looking for someone who has personally owned backend systems that other teams and customers relied on.

Responsibilities:

Own the backend architecture and services supporting MediaViz's production media intelligence platform.

Design and maintain the end-to-end media processing pipeline, from client upload through job orchestration, model inference, result aggregation, persistence, and delivery.

Build and operate distributed inference infrastructure for containerized machine learning services using queue-driven asynchronous processing and workload-based scaling.

Design systems for bursty workloads, including concurrency control, backpressure, retries, idempotency, failure recovery, and dead-letter handling.

Design, build, and maintain REST APIs and associated client SDKs.

Own the application data layer, including PostgreSQL on Amazon RDS and OpenSearch-based search and retrieval systems.

Maintain semantic search infrastructure using embeddings and Amazon Bedrock.

Manage application deployments and production infrastructure across development, staging, and production environments.

Maintain logging, monitoring, alerting, and operational visibility for production systems.

Diagnose performance, scalability, and reliability issues across distributed services.

Maintain infrastructure as code and contribute to CI/CD, security, access control, and production readiness practices.

Establish and maintain appropriate automated testing for backend services and infrastructure.

Participate in architecture decisions and technical planning for backend and infrastructure systems.

Required Qualifications:

5+ years of professional backend software development experience, with substantial production experience in Python.

Demonstrated ownership of production backend systems used by customers or other engineering teams.

Strong experience designing and operating asynchronous or distributed processing systems.

Experience building systems around message queues, including idempotency, retries, backpressure, failure handling, and dead-letter queues.

Deep production experience with AWS, including: Lambda, including container-image functions, SQS, S3, RDS/PostgreSQL, IAM, CloudWatch, CloudFront

Experience with infrastructure as code using Terraform or CloudFormation.

Strong Docker experience and practical experience deploying containerized production workloads.

Experience deploying and serving machine learning models in production environments.

Experience designing and maintaining REST APIs.

Strong PostgreSQL experience, including schema design, indexing, query optimization, migrations, and production operations.

Experience implementing production monitoring, logging, alerting, and incident diagnosis.

Familiarity with CI/CD and automated testing for production backend systems.

Strong understanding of cloud security fundamentals, particularly IAM, secrets management, least-privilege access, and network boundaries.
